Qian Heng insisted that Cheng Yao attend the alumni gathering with him. Thinking he meant well, she agreed. After meeting several old classmates, Qian Heng announced that Cheng Yao was his girlfriend and that they were both currently focused on their careers with no plans to marry. However, Cheng Yao wasn’t happy. She asked Qian Heng why he hadn’t discussed it with her first. Qian Heng thought she meant the marriage part, but Cheng Yao clarified she meant making their relationship public—or in fact, every decision. She wanted respect and understanding, not to be treated as Qian Heng’s accessory. Qian Heng tried to explain, but Cheng Yao didn’t want to hear it.
Qian Heng was puzzled—he thought announcing their relationship was a joyful thing. Why did it make Cheng Yao feel disrespected? Wu Jun suggested he reflect on what Cheng Yao truly wanted. Cheng Yao confided in Cheng Xi about her feelings. Cheng Xi encouraged her to look into her own heart. If she still wanted to be with Qian Heng, she should work hard to improve herself and earn the respect she deserved.
Jincheng took on a new case. Li Chengxuan told Cheng Yao that the client, Chen Linli, had been in a hot air balloon accident while traveling abroad with her husband. The balloon crashed. Her husband and son couldn’t be saved, and she suffered a mild concussion but no life-threatening injuries. After returning to China, she began handling her husband's estate. Her mother-in-law demanded half the shares of Kaili Company, but Chen Linli refused and offered real estate or cash of equal value instead. She lost the first trial and requested Cheng Yao for the appeal. Li Chengxuan told Cheng Yao it was her choice whether to accept the case. Cheng Yao felt that since the client had chosen her, she shouldn’t shirk the responsibility.
Cheng Yao met with Chen Linli, who revealed that her mother-in-law, Huang Ran, had hired Qian Heng as her lawyer. In the industry, almost no one could defeat Qian Heng—unless he had a concern, and that could only be his girlfriend, Cheng Yao. Cheng Yao realized Chen Linli’s intent and stated that she wouldn’t let personal feelings interfere with work. She would take the case and rely on her own abilities to represent it.
When Qian Heng learned Cheng Yao would be his opponent, he advised her to give up voluntarily. In court, he said, he would be loyal only to the law, with no regard for relationships. Cheng Yao replied that he didn’t need to worry—she hoped he would give it his all. That way, win or lose, it would be fulfilling.
Cheng Xi joined Junheng as a partner and specifically set up a pro bono case group. On her first day, she felt the atmosphere was tense. Wu Jun told her that ever since Cheng Yao took the Chen Linli case, Qian Heng had been in a bad mood and kept losing his temper. Everyone in the office was afraid to speak. Cheng Xi realized that Qian Heng truly loved Cheng Yao and was comforted by the thought.
Cheng Yao, feeling down, went to Li Mengting’s place to talk. She suddenly received a call from Gu Beiqing saying Chen Linli had just attempted suicide and rushed to the hospital.
Chen Linli told Cheng Yao that it had been her husband’s birthday. She had instinctively ordered a cake before realizing he’d never eat it again. The wave of grief had overwhelmed her, leading to her actions. Seeing Chen Linli’s deep love for her husband, Cheng Yao asked why she refused to divide the company shares. Chen Linli explained that Kaili had been built through their joint efforts. Now that her husband was gone, the company was her only connection to him. Her mother-in-law didn’t understand how startups operated and might be manipulated by other shareholders into raising the stock price, eventually leading to her being sidelined. That would mean the collapse of what they had built together, so she insisted on keeping the shares intact.
Cheng Yao began interviewing other passengers who had ridden the hot air balloon with Chen Linli. They all said the entire family was injured, and Chen Linli had ignored her own wounds to seek help for her husband and son. Although they weren’t saved, she had tried.
To help Qian Heng, Cheng Xi used a business trip as an excuse to ask him to look after her dog, Megatron. Since he had no experience with dogs, he asked Cheng Yao to meet and give him some tips. When they met, Cheng Yao said she only agreed because of the case. She had investigated and found that Chen Linli wasn’t someone who would only care about herself. She hoped they could reach a settlement before the second trial.
Qian Heng, drawing on his years of legal experience, told her a settlement was unlikely. As a lawyer, his duty was to fight for his client’s best interests, and Huang Ran was resolute—he couldn’t persuade her. Cheng Yao showed him her investigation video, saying she believed the law had warmth, and that marriage was about more than protecting property—it also protected love.
